Little 'girl' Archie

Hello, I have another card to show you today.
For this card, i've used DigiStamp Boutique's Valentine Archie, which is on offer this month for just 95p.



As you can see, Archie is actually a little girl on this card as i've added a little pink bow to 'her' head.
If you don't want to add a bow yourself, you can buy Valentine Olivia instead who already has a little bow for you to colour. I like the option to add a bow if I need to.
The backing paper is by EK Success and is called pollyanna. I found this paper amongst some mixed sheets I bought years ago when I first started card making but have never used.
I've used SU boho blossoms punch for the flowers, adding pink crystals for a bit of added bling.
The white leaves were die cut using a Marianne creatables die, they actually look a little lost in this pic, but IRL they do stand out much better.
The sentiment is computer generated.
